I cannot figure out how to build commercial ships and sea routes
The FIrst Era advance "Harbour infra structures" says it will allow us to build brigentines. Cannot see how to do.
Second era advance "industrialized ports" says it will allow us to build packets. Cannot see how to do.
Since commercial sea routes seem to require a merchant ship, this may be the problem with them.
Suggestions?

Building ships and assigning trade routes for them can only be seen from the Economic view screen, which is activated by the buttons on the bottom left of your main game screen.
From this map all potential trade routes, their potential income values and most importantly, their multiple interactions are all viewed from here.

After what ZZ said you just drop your ship over a port to establish a trade route.
The ship gets brighter once its over a port. Its tricky to get just the right position to drop it on the port, so watch for the ship getting brighter.
